TMZ founder Harvey Levin on Wednesday said his company has received a third alleged letter in connection with the disappearance of Savannah’s Guthrie’s mother Nancy Guthrie, this one claiming to know the identity of the kidnapper.

Appearing on “America’s Newsroom,” Levin told Bill Hemmer: “An hour and a half ago, we got, kind of a bizarre letter, an email from somebody who says they know who the kidnapper is and that they have tried reaching Savannah’s sister Annie and Savannah’s brother, to no avail.

“And they said they want one Bitcoin sent to a Bitcoin address that we have confirmed is active. It’s a real Bitcoin address, and as they put it, time is more than relevant. So we have no idea whether this is real or not. But they are making a demand.”

“It’s interesting that Bitcoins fluctuate in value, but it’s around $56,000 now, one Bitcoin, which is about the amount that the authorities are offering for information leading to the return of Nancy. So I don’t know if that aligns, but whoever sent this, and they actually give a name and an email address, but whoever sent this is asking for around that amount.”

Levin added: “They’re not saying they’re the kidnapper, they say they know who the kidnapper is.”

Meanwhile, former FBI assistant director Chris Swecker told “The Faulkner Focus” he is “highly skeptical” about that new note.

“I just don’t think anything TMZ has brought forward has panned out. I mean it’s a good vehicle for people to come in and do this, TMZ gets some viewership and it sort of ties up the investigative team trying to run this down. But I sense a scam here,” Swecker said.

“I may be absolutely wrong, I hope I am, I love to think that this is a viable lead but I think it’s one of many hundreds that are coming in through the proper channels, which is the FBI tip line. Bottom line is I’m very skeptical of it.”

Authorities have now released package deliveryman Carlos Palazuelos, who told Matt Finn of Fox News he was questioned in connection to the disappearance of Nancy, 84, but had nothing to do with it.

He called his experience with police “terrifying,” saying, “I felt like I was being kidnapped, bro, because they didn’t tell me anything at the beginning.”

He said he was unsure if he ever had delivered a package to Guthrie’s house, saying it “might have been a possibility.”

He said authorities showed his in-law a picture of someone wearing a mask and “they supposedly looked like my eyes.”

“That’s it. That’s all I know,” he added.

On Tuesday, FBI Director Kash Patel released new video and still images of an armed man, who was wearing a mask and gloves and carrying a backpack, recorded on Guthrie’s doorbell camera.
